Job summary

The University of Kansas Health System in Liberty, MO, is seeking a Board Eligible/Board Certified Cardiothoracic Surgeon to join its team. This role offers a unique opportunity to practice in a high-intensity community setting while also engaging in academia with the University of Kansas School of Medicine.

The ideal candidate will provide surgical care, participate in a multidisciplinary tumor board, and have a strong commitment to high-quality patient outcomes. A competitive compensation package and a vibrant community await.

Magnet designation is proof of our hard-earned commitment to nursing excellence.**About The University of Kansas Health System - Liberty Campus:**The city of Liberty, Missouri is a suburb of Kansas City, commonly referred to as the “Northland.” Serving the healthcare needs of the community for nearly 50 years, Liberty Hospital is a 204-licensed bed medical center, Level II trauma center, and primary stroke center. Our mission is to work in partnership with our community to improve the health, safety, and well-being of those we serve. The hospital has consistently received an “A” safety grade for the last four years from The Leapfrog Group. **About Liberty, Missouri:**The City of Liberty, Missouri offers an award-winning public school system, a local college, and a vibrant historic downtown business district with retail, dining, and business offices. The City’s 29 square miles is serviced by excellent local municipal services like police, fire, water, and sewer. With a population of just over 30,000, the city offers the best combination of economic opportunities, diverse housing, award winning parks, safe streets and neighborhoods, a variety of things to do and a friendly sense of community. Recreation - Home to more than 500 acres of park land and more than 10 miles of trails offering plenty of opportunity for play and exercise. Capitol Federal Sports Complex is a nationally recognized facility that hosts numerous local, regional, and national baseball, softball and soccer tournaments and leagues throughout the year. The national tournaments attract teams from coast to coast.History, Arts and Cultural - The community includes seven historic districts and over 240 preserved homes and buildings many of which are listed on the National Register of Historic places.Location - We are just 15 minutes from downtown and 15 minutes from Kansas City International Airport.**About Kansas City (located 15 minutes from Liberty):**A metropolitan area of 2.3 million people, Kansas City offers the diversity and excitement of a large city with the charm and convenience of Midwest living.
